What Is a Fishing Requisites Trading License?

Infographic: How to Get a Fishing Requisites Trading License in Dubai

A Fishing Requisites Trading License (Activity Code 4763.92) is a Trading License issued under the Trading category. It permits the holder to buy and sell goods directly associated with fishing activities. This includes a broad range of products such as fishing rods, reels, lines, hooks, lures, nets, tackle boxes, bait, floats, sinkers, and other accessories used in both recreational and commercial fishing.

The license is issued through Dubai South Business Hub Free Zone, one of the UAE's most strategically located free zones, situated adjacent to Al Maktoum International Airport and the Jebel Ali Port corridor. Businesses operating under this license can trade, import, export, and re-export fishing requisites within the free zone and internationally.

Why Dubai Is Well-Positioned for This Trade

Dubai's geographic position at the crossroads of Asia, Africa, and Europe makes it an exceptional base for fishing requisites trading. The UAE has over 1,300 kilometres of coastline, and recreational fishing is a popular leisure activity among both residents and tourists. The country's commercial fishing industry also supports consistent domestic demand for quality equipment.

Beyond local consumption, Dubai's world-class logistics infrastructure enables efficient re-export to markets across South Asia, East Africa, and the broader Middle East. Jebel Ali Port is the largest port in the Middle East and among the top ten busiest container ports globally, providing unparalleled access to international shipping routes. Al Maktoum International Airport, located within Dubai South, adds further air freight capability for high-value or time-sensitive cargo.

Setup Costs and Steps

Setting up a Fishing Requisites Trading License at Dubai South Business Hub Free Zone involves a clear and manageable process. Costs vary depending on the package selected, the number of visas required, and whether a physical office or flexi-desk arrangement is chosen. Typical setup costs for a basic trading license start from approximately AED 12,500 to AED 20,000, inclusive of registration and license fees. Visa costs, office space, and additional government fees are charged separately.

The general steps to obtain your license are as follows:

  • Choose your business activity and confirm Activity Code 4763.92 applies to your intended trade

  • Select a company name and ensure it complies with UAE naming conventions

  • Submit your application to Dubai South Business Hub Free Zone with the required documents

  • Provide passport copies, a business plan summary, and proof of address for all shareholders

  • Pay the applicable license and registration fees

  • Receive your trade license and proceed with visa applications and bank account opening

The entire process typically takes between three and seven business days once all documentation is in order.

Licensing and Compliance Requirements

Businesses holding a Fishing Requisites Trading License must operate within the scope of their approved activity. Key compliance considerations include:

  • Annual license renewal to maintain good standing with the free zone authority

  • Adherence to UAE customs regulations for import and re-export activities

  • Compliance with UAE corporate tax registration requirements introduced in 2023

  • Maintaining accurate financial records and, where applicable, filing tax returns with the Federal Tax Authority

  • Ensuring all products traded meet relevant UAE product safety and labelling standards
